Some action camera BMS systems only map the battery-remaining indicator accurately after completing one charge cycle from within the camera body itself.\u003c\/li\u003e\n  \u003c\/ul\u003e\n\n  \u003chr class=\"bpw-desc-divider\"\u003e\n\n  \u003ch3 class=\"bpw-desc-h3\"\u003eBattery percentage jumping erratically on the HT200 display\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\n  \u003cp class=\"bpw-desc-p\"\u003eThe HT200 maps battery percentage against a fixed voltage-threshold table calibrated to the original cell's discharge curve. A replacement cell with a slightly different internal resistance will produce voltage readings that don't line up with those thresholds. The indicator can jump from 80% to 40% mid-session or stall at one level for an extended period before dropping sharply. Running one complete charge-discharge cycle inside the camera body allows the BMS to recalibrate against the new cell's actual curve.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n  \u003ch3 class=\"bpw-desc-h3\"\u003eCamera showing dead battery indicator on a partially charged replacement cell\u003c\/h3\u003e\n  \u003cp class=\"bpw-desc-p\"\u003eThis happens when the camera's low-voltage cutoff triggers against a new cell that arrived partially discharged from storage. The BMS reads the resting voltage, sees it near the cutoff threshold, and flags it as depleted before the cell has had a chance to condition. Place the cell in the camera and charge it fully via USB before attempting to power on. Once it reaches 4.2V at the termination point, the indicator should clear and the camera will boot normally.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e","brand":"BatteryWeb","offers":[{"title":"Warranty 1 Year","offer_id":43333868716122,"sku":"BWCS-NP120FU-1","price":23.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true},{"title":"Warranty 2 Year","offer_id":43333868748890,"sku":"BWCS-NP120FU-2","price":26.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true},{"title":"Warranty 3 Year","offer_id":43333868781658,"sku":"BWCS-NP120FU-3","price":28.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0674\/4775\/0746\/files\/BW-CS-NP120FU-1.webp?v=1778213403","url":"https:\/\/batteryweb.com\/products\/sports-camera-ht200-replacement-battery-37v-1800mah-li-ion","provider":"BatteryWeb","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
